
Driver Arrested for Fatal Minnesota Crash
Fridley, MN (KROC-AM News)- One motorist is dead and another was arrested following a fatal crash in the Twin Cities on Monday.

A news release issued by the Anoka County Sheriff’s Office says first responders were dispatched to the deadly crash shortly before 11 a.m.
The fatal collision sent both vehicles off the roadway. The drivers were the only people involved.

One Killed, One Arrested for Fatal Crash in Fridley, MN
The initial crash investigation indicates an SUV, traveling south in the 6600 block East River Rd. in Fridley, smashed into a sedan that was heading the same direction.
An adult male driving the sedan was pronounced dead at the scene, according to a news release. His name has not been released.
Authorities say the driver of the SUV, also described as an adult man, was taken to a hospital for treatment of what appear to be minor injuries he suffered in the crash.
Law enforcement then placed under arrest and took him to the Anoka County Jail. The suspect, who’s name has not been released, has not yet been formally charged, the news release says.
Officials say the Fridley Police Department, Minnesota State Patrol, Midwest Medical Examiner’s Office, and Anoka County Sheriff’s Office are continuing to investigate the fatal crash.
No other information is available for release as of Tuesday morning.
